The first key part of pool and water safety is blocking access to any unsupervised body of water, whether that body of water is a pool, a pond, a river, or a ditch. You can block access to these bodies of water with fences, walls, or simple pool alarms. The second key part of pool and water safety is teaching your children how to swim. Even young babies, as small as a year old, can learn the basics of swimming, such as how to float, or staying calm if you fall into a pool.
